Ayah of Sajdah on Radio

Answered as per Hanafi Fiqh by CouncilofUlama.co.za

Q: If one hears an Ayah of Sajdah from an audio recording or on a radio station  – is it necessary to make a Sajdah Tilawah?

A: Sajdah Tilawah is a Sajdah that one has to perform as an obligatory duty when one reads, recites, or hears, in the Salaah or outside of Salaah, some specific verses containing the words of Sajdah in them. There are 14 such verses in the  Quraan. These are indicated by the word ‘As Sajdah’ shown in the margin.

Keeping the above in mind, Sajda Tilaawah is not necessary if an Aayah of Sajdah is heard from an audio recording or a radio station. However, if the recitation is on the radio is live, then Sajda Tilawah will be necessary.
